Description - Spectralink DECTMedia Resource
The Spectralink DECTMedia Resource is a print board that is placed within the same rack next to
the Spectralink IP-DECT Server 6500 board. Up to 2 Spectralink DECTMedia Resources can be
placed in the same rack that houses the Spectralink IP-DECT Server 6500 board.
The Spectralink DECTMedia Resource performs media conversion between the call handler and
the Spectralink IP-DECT Server 6500 and is the media termination point for incoming and outgoing
calls. Each Spectralink IP-DECT Server 6500 contains one built in media resource. The Spectralink
IP-DECT Server 6500 can support a total of 32 Spectralink DECTMedia Resources.
Each Spectralink DECTMedia Resource adds 32 voice channels. The maximum number of sim-
ultaneous calls for a fully loaded system is 1024 calls at the same time. Depending on codec choice,
the number of voice channels per Media Resource card can vary from 12 - 32.
G.726 allows for 32 duplex speech channels as this codec requires no processing and is routed dir-
ectly to the Spectralink IP-DECT Base Station. Other codecs such as G.711 or G.729 must be con-
verted to G.726 before routed further on to the Spectralink IP-DECT Base Station and this affects
the total number of available speech channels on the Spectralink DECTMedia Resource, lowering
the number of speech channels down to 12 if all calls utilize the G.729 codec.
The Spectralink DECTMedia Resource connects directly with the LAN and must operate in con-
junction with the Spectralink IP-DECT Server 6500. If using clusters, the Spectralink DECTMedia
Resources can be placed at different locations.
The Spectralink DECTMedia Resource contains no radio parts. It ships from the factory configured
for DHCP. Should it enter an unrecoverable state, it can be reset to factory default settings when the
reset button is pressed and held for more than 5 seconds.
